Push

Description

Push

Usage

push(
  object = ".",
  name = NULL,
  refspec = NULL,
  force = FALSE,
  credentials = NULL,
  set_upstream = FALSE
)

Arguments

object

path to repository, or a git_repository or git_branch.

name

The remote's name. Default is NULL.

refspec

The refspec to be pushed. Default is NULL.

force

Force your local revision to the remote repo. Use it with care. Default is FALSE.

credentials

The credentials for remote repository access. Default is NULL. To use and query an ssh-agent for the ssh key credentials, let this parameter be NULL (the default).

set_upstream

Set the current local branch to track the remote branch. Default is FALSE.

Value

invisible(NULL)

See Also

cred_user_pass, cred_ssh_key

Examples

## Not run: 
## Initialize two temporary repositories
path_bare <- tempfile(pattern="git2r-")
path_repo <- tempfile(pattern="git2r-")
dir.create(path_bare)
dir.create(path_repo)
repo_bare <- init(path_bare, bare = TRUE)

## Clone the bare repository. This creates remote-tracking
## branches for each branch in the cloned repository.
repo <- clone(path_bare, path_repo)

## Config user and commit a file
config(repo, user.name = "Alice", user.email = "alice@example.org")

## Write to a file and commit
lines <- "Lorem ipsum dolor sit amet, consectetur adipisicing elit, sed do"
writeLines(lines, file.path(path_repo, "example.txt"))
add(repo, "example.txt")
commit(repo, "First commit message")

## Push commits from repository to bare repository
push(repo, "origin", "refs/heads/master")

## Now, unset the remote-tracking branch to NULL to demonstrate
## the 'set_upstream' argument. Then push with 'set_upstream = TRUE'
## to add the upstream tracking branch to branch 'master' again.
branch_get_upstream(repository_head(repo))
branch_set_upstream(repository_head(repo), NULL)
branch_get_upstream(repository_head(repo))
push(repo, "origin", "refs/heads/master", set_upstream = TRUE)
branch_get_upstream(repository_head(repo))

## Change file and commit
lines <- c(
  "Lorem ipsum dolor sit amet, consectetur adipisicing elit, sed do",
  "eiusmod tempor incididunt ut labore et dolore magna aliqua.")
writeLines(lines, file.path(path_repo, "example.txt"))
add(repo, "example.txt")
commit(repo, "Second commit message")

## Push commits from repository to bare repository
push(repo)

## List commits in repository and bare repository
commits(repo)
commits(repo_bare)

## End(Not run)
